Limiter delete

I just found out today, but it has been for the longest. A automobile computer electronics store is modifying RA computer to rev up to 10 k RPM, and installing a fuel controller to activate as the car reaches 5,200 RPM...the efect of the "controller" is a surge in fuel and spark when the car reaches the above mentioned RPM. I know better cuz I have it done in my Mirage. The RPM gig is just for gimmick unless you can get your hands on a cam...that and that it sounds so awesome to rev to 8k.

But just to inform though. I called just to see if they had something else and they told me about the ECU "MOD"

I have it in the other car and its pretty nice when it pulls like some other kind of V V T do explode on the cam
